Location

This hotel is situated in the centre of Tours close to St. Gatien Cathedral. The hotel is only 200 m from the nearest public transport stop.

Facility

The hotel has 92 rooms, including 8 single rooms, which are located on 8 storeys and are reachable by 2 lifts. English- and French-speaking staff at the reception desk in the lobby are happy to answer any questions. Amenities include a baggage storage service, a safe and a currency exchange service. Wireless internet access in public areas allows guests to stay connected. The hotel offers various facilities for guests with disabilities. Wheelchair-accessible facilities are available. There are also a number of shops that make for great strolling and browsing. Additional amenities include a TV room and a playroom. Guests arriving by car can park their vehicles in the garage or in the car park. Further services and facilities include a 24-hour security service, a transfer service, room service, a laundry service and a coin-operated laundry. Complimentary newspapers are available. A business centre with fax machine and projector is available.

Rooms

Air conditioning and central heating ensure that rooms maintain comfortable temperatures. The rooms have a king-size bed and a sofa bed. Extra beds can be requested. A safe, a minibar and a desk are also available. Guests will also find a tea/coffee station included among the standard features. An ironing set is provided for guests' convenience. A direct dial telephone, a TV and WiFi (no extra charge) are provided as well. Slippers are included. A hairdryer and a telephone are available in the bathrooms, which are equipped with a shower and a bathtub. Guests can also book wheelchair-friendly rooms with wheelchair-accessible bathrooms. The hotel has family rooms and non-smoking rooms.

    I was one of the lucky ones in our party, who got a decent size room. The overall impression is dated, but not completely worn down.The restaurant is for breakfast only - and you need to go to the city center to eat lunch / dinner. There is a restaurant at the Novotel down the road, but it is closed during the weekend.The elevator was stuck twice during the week we stayed - we spent the weekend in Paris - and when we came back on the evening 16th of September one elevator was not functioning - and when I pressed the button on the other elevator "Up" - nothing happened. I asked the receptionist if the elevator was working and she reacted in every shape and form - body language, deep sigh and eyes in the sky as if I was a complete moron that I didn't know that I should have pressed "Down" - to get up.Unstable elevators is of course pretty bad - but worse was that when the elevator was too busy we tried to use the fire escape - and it was blocked on the ground floor - that is quite frankly ridiculous ad just too dangerous.     Having just arrived from a Mecure in Clermont-Ferrand, to call this hotel a Mecure, damages the brands name. The whole hotel is in need of a major revamp. On arriving at your room, you always want to feel that it's adequate for a good night sleep. The very thin sheet right on top of the unprotected mattress did not give me that impression !The room looked dated. There was a rip in the blackout curtains backing. We were facing the railway, and the soundproofing was adequate. The fridge had been removed, but the extension lead and space for it was still in place, and on mentioning it the next day to reception, the reply was, "Only Privilege rooms have them" . Which we knew was wrong as we were travelling as a 4 and our friends had a fridge. Their room was just as dated as ours.
